Waste-to-Energy Technologies



With waste generation rising, finding lasting solutions is ending up being progressively important. Waste-to-Energy (WtE) modern technologies supply an encouraging method to handling our waste while creating energy. These modern technologies include transforming non-recyclable waste products right into functional kinds of energy like electrical energy, warm, or fuel.



By diverting waste from landfills and incinerating it in regulated setups, WtE not just reduces the quantity of waste yet likewise creates valuable power resources.

One typical method of WtE is mass-burn incineration, where waste is burned at heats to generate heavy steam that drives wind turbines generating electricity. One more approach is gasification, which transforms waste into artificial gas that can be utilized for power generation or as a chemical feedstock.

Additionally, anaerobic food digestion breaks down natural waste to produce biogas for power.

Carrying out WtE innovations can help reduce greenhouse gas discharges, decrease dependence on fossil fuels, and reduce the ecological effect of garbage disposal.
